tanhf (example 3.4)

Time bar (total: 2.7s)

start0.0ms (0%)

Memory
0.1MiB live, 0.1MiB allocated; 0ms collecting garbage

analyze136.0ms (5.1%)

Memory
11.7MiB live, 183.1MiB allocated; 72ms collecting garbage
Algorithm
search
Search
ProbabilityValidUnknownPreconditionInfiniteDomainCan'tIter
0%0%100%0%0%0%0%0
0%0%100%0%0%0%0%1
0%0%100%0%0%0%0%2
25%25%75%0%0%0%0%3
37.5%37.5%62.5%0%0%0%0%4
43.8%43.7%56.2%0%0%0%0%5
46.9%46.9%53.1%0%0%0%0%6
48.4%48.4%51.5%0%0%0%0%7
49.2%49.2%50.8%0%0%0%0%8
49.6%49.6%50.4%0%0%0%0%9
49.8%49.8%50.2%0%0%0%0%10
49.9%49.9%50.1%0%0%0%0%11
50%49.9%50%0%0%0%0%12
Compiler

Compiled 9 to 8 computations (11.1% saved)

sample2.2s (81.5%)

Memory
38.7MiB live, 1 665.4MiB allocated; 941ms collecting garbage
Samples
770.0ms4 200×0valid
634.0ms2 218×2valid
284.0ms631×3valid
180.0ms1 200×1valid
9.0ms4valid
Precisions
Click to see histograms. Total time spent on operations: 1.6s
ival-cos: 771.0ms (48.7% of total)
ival-sin: 428.0ms (27% of total)
adjust: 183.0ms (11.6% of total)
ival-div: 105.0ms (6.6% of total)
ival-sub: 86.0ms (5.4% of total)
exact: 7.0ms (0.4% of total)
ival-assert: 3.0ms (0.2% of total)
Bogosity

explain193.0ms (7.2%)

Memory
28.3MiB live, 121.1MiB allocated; 7ms collecting garbage
FPErrors
Click to see full error table
Ground TruthOverpredictionsExampleUnderpredictionsExampleSubexpression
690-1(-6.1209912042489515e+137)(-.f64 #s(literal 1 binary64) (cos.f64 x))
610-1(4.035165968608097e-158)(/.f64 (-.f64 #s(literal 1 binary64) (cos.f64 x)) (sin.f64 x))
00-0-#s(literal 1 binary64)
00-0-(cos.f64 x)
00-0-(sin.f64 x)
00-0-x
Explanations
Click to see full explanations table
OperatorSubexpressionExplanationCount
-.f64(-.f64 #s(literal 1 binary64) (cos.f64 x))cancellation683
/.f64(/.f64 (-.f64 #s(literal 1 binary64) (cos.f64 x)) (sin.f64 x))u/n600
(-.f64 #s(literal 1 binary64) (cos.f64 x))underflow60
Confusion
Predicted +Predicted -
+1281
-0127
Precision
1.0
Recall
0.9922480620155039
Confusion?
Predicted +Predicted MaybePredicted -
+12810
-02125
Precision?
0.9847328244274809
Recall?
1.0
Freqs
test
numberfreq
0128
1128
Total Confusion?
Predicted +Predicted MaybePredicted -
+100
-000
Precision?
1.0
Recall?
1.0
Samples
41.0ms144×2valid
31.0ms274×0valid
20.0ms40×3valid
6.0ms54×1valid
Compiler

Compiled 45 to 22 computations (51.1% saved)

Precisions
Click to see histograms. Total time spent on operations: 81.0ms
ival-cos: 47.0ms (58.2% of total)
ival-sin: 11.0ms (13.6% of total)
adjust: 10.0ms (12.4% of total)
ival-div: 6.0ms (7.4% of total)
ival-sub: 5.0ms (6.2% of total)
ival-assert: 0.0ms (0% of total)
ival-true: 0.0ms (0% of total)
exact: 0.0ms (0% of total)

preprocess167.0ms (6.2%)

Memory
-9.1MiB live, 89.0MiB allocated; 13ms collecting garbage
Iterations

Useful iterations: 0 (0.0ms)

IterNodesCost
01213
14013
27812
315212
439212
5144712
089
0179
1269
2359
3489
4849
52889
621929
770149
082579
Stop Event
iter limit
node limit
iter limit
node limit

end0.0ms (0%)

Memory
0.0MiB live, 0.0MiB allocated; 0ms collecting garbage

Profiling

Loading profile data...